Output b4de9b8c0342765af680885fd6bb101667c8fa919c8c0d881b715db8113e05ae:23

value
2518595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54af9bcf64ce5fd6e53ad31449b130b1146736f8 OP_EQUAL
address
39Qo4AC159PaofU7o7yU4q7JTF37dcRYef
transaction
b4de9b8c0342765af680885fd6bb101667c8fa919c8c0d881b715db8113e05ae
confirmations
280923
spent
true